DI PCG is a Gradio Demo designed for generating 3D models from 2D images. It leverages advanced AI technology to create detailed and accurate 3D representations, making it a powerful tool for 3D modeling and design. The application simplifies the process of converting flat images into three-dimensional objects, catering to both professionals and hobbyists.
What file formats does DI PCG support?
DI PCG supports common image formats like PNG, JPG, and JPEG for input. The output 3D models are typically in formats such as OBJ, STL, or GLB.
